Войти
Регистрация
Спроси ai-bota
В
Все
М
Математика
О
ОБЖ
У
Українська мова
Д
Другие предметы
Х
Химия
М
Музыка
Н
Немецкий язык
Б
Беларуская мова
Э
Экономика
Ф
Физика
Б
Биология
О
Окружающий мир
Р
Русский язык
У
Українська література
Ф
Французский язык
П
Психология
А
Алгебра
О
Обществознание
М
МХК
В
Видео-ответы
Г
География
П
Право
Г
Геометрия
А
Английский язык
И
Информатика
Қ
Қазақ тiлi
Л
Литература
И
История
Показать больше
Показать меньше
умка222
09.05.2023 09:54 •
Информатика
С++ закодируйте фразу 'съешь же ещё этих мягких французских булок, да выпей чаю' с шифра цезаря. со сдвигом на 7.
Показать ответ
Ответ:
kamilhabirov
08.10.2020 03:11
Dec C++
#include <iostream>
#include <cstring>
using namespace std;
int main()
{
setlocale (LC_CTYPE, "Russian");
char alpha[] = "";
char buff[]="Съешь же ещё этих мягких французских булок, да выпей чаю.";
int n = 66, k=7;
k %= n;
for (int i = 0; i < sizeof(buff)-1; ++i)
if (strchr(alpha,buff[i]))
buff[i] = alpha[(strchr(alpha,buff[i])-alpha+k) % n];
cout<<buff<<endl;
system("pause");
return 0;
}
0,0
(0 оценок)
Популярные вопросы: Информатика
артемий59
25.06.2021 03:49
Составить программу (while) вывода на печать суммы чисел от 1 до 10....
dasha281182
03.07.2021 09:32
На рисунке 9 изображена современная цифровая техника.какие функции выполнять каждую из перечисленных устройств...
SuperWalker
16.06.2022 07:05
Выбери два любых предмета и исследуйте их при пяти восприятия информации. запиши результаты исследования. ...
Webymnyaha
06.06.2020 22:31
запишите в тетради программу, выполняя которую робот сначала проедет вперед, потом — назад, потом — снова вперед, и так будет продолжать бесконечно долго....
arrgitori
01.06.2022 08:06
Какой единицей обозначающего символьную скорость , измерялась скорость модемов: а) бит б) бар в)flops г) бод...
професор3814
19.09.2021 11:31
По информатике 7 класс дано число если оно чётное вывести yes если не чёрное то no...
саша4265
19.09.2021 11:31
Шифр виженера. этот шифр представляет собой шифр цезаря с переменной величиной сдвига.величину сдвига ключевым словом. например, ключевое слово ваза, означает следующую последовательность...
лисичка009
19.09.2021 11:31
Подготовить сообщение на тему «кодирование информации...
2005161718
07.02.2021 10:13
1. каково основное предназначение перечислите основные элементы web-страницы.3. в чём основное отличие гипертекстовых документов от обычных? 4. какое программное обеспечение...
kotiki2017
07.02.2021 10:13
При регистрации в интернет-магазине пользователю автоматически создается пароль, состоящий только из цифр от0 до 9. пароль состоит из 8 символов и кодируется одинаковым, минимально...
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ota
Оформи подписку
О НАС
О нас
Блог
Карьера
Условия пользования
Авторское право
Политика конфиденциальности
Политика использования файлов cookie
Предпочтения cookie-файлов
СООБЩЕСТВО
Сообщество
Для школ
Родителям
Кодекс чести
Правила сообщества
Insights
Стань помощником
ПОМОЩЬ
Зарегистрируйся
Центр помощи
Центр безопасности
Договор о конфиденциальности полученной информации
App
Начни делиться знаниями
Вход
Регистрация
Что ты хочешь узнать?
Спроси ai-бота
#include <iostream>
#include <cstring>
using namespace std;
int main()
{
setlocale (LC_CTYPE, "Russian");
char alpha[] = "";
char buff[]="Съешь же ещё этих мягких французских булок, да выпей чаю.";
int n = 66, k=7;
k %= n;
for (int i = 0; i < sizeof(buff)-1; ++i)
if (strchr(alpha,buff[i]))
buff[i] = alpha[(strchr(alpha,buff[i])-alpha+k) % n];
cout<<buff<<endl;
system("pause");
return 0;
}